Just got a letter from the Director of the NCC (National Computer Center) inviting me to be one of the panel of judges for the 2006 Search for Best Local Government Website as part of NCC’s eLGU Project.
I didn’t know there was something like this going on but with a quick search I found their website here.
The contest, which officially started last July 24, 2006 with the call for submission of entries is aimed at encouraging LGUs to establish and maintain an official site in the World Wide Web. It is also meant to inspire other LGUs to continue to enhance their sites and improve the delivery of online services to the public.
